Name: CodeFilter_6xx v1.01

Description This modification prevents users from posting executable Javascript code within a UBBCode tag.

Author: el84

Compatibility: Tested on 6.01, 6.02, and 6.03

Link: http://el84.addr.com/ubbmods/CodeFilter_6xx_101.txt

Revision History:
v1.00 - Initial release for UBB 6.01
v1.01 - Changed instructions for UBB6.02 and 6.03

To Do: Wordletize error messages.

This is not a security enhancement. Wish I could say it adds some cool new feature, but it doesn't. All it does is prevent users from embedding Javascript in UBB Code tags. And it does so without filtering any Javascript keywords.

Please carefully read the description of this mod in the instructions.

I'll be honest. I don't think this mod needs to go gold. That implies the error messages would be wordletized.

Here's what I'd like to see happen with this mod:
  • Any flaws (leaks) in the code are found and fixed
  • The code that applies to the standard UBB6 would be incorporated into a future UBB6 release.
  • The code that applies to UBB Code Buttons gets added to the UBB Code Buttons mod.


If Infopop incorporates the code, they will use their own hack-warning wordlet. So, no need for me to do that now. Then, UBB Code Buttons mod can use the same warning wordlet.

I bet this mod will be obsolete and unnecessary soon. That would make me happy.
